Powernova’s current business activities are focused on proceeding with the development of a heterogeneous (solid) catalyst in addition to the homogeneous (liquid) catalyst that was first developed by the company.
This new technology being developed in Russia has the promise of altering the economics of hydrogen production by producing low cost hydrogen from hydrocarbons by breaking catalytically the carbon-hydrogen bond in liquid fuels with a chemical reaction between 150° - 200°C, compared to the present high cost industry practice of steam reforming at a temperature range between 700° - 900°C.
In the motor vehicle industry, the development of a solid catalyst has greater potential for commercial success than the liquid catalyst as this technology has the potential for onboard production in a motor vehicle of hydrogen from a blended gasoline to power a fuel cell electric motor vehicle with zero carbon dioxide emissions, while at the same time utilizing the existing petroleum fuel distribution system for motor vehicles.
